Just a day in the life of a Birth to 3 Home Visitor!
Miss Hannah worked on introducing early math skills with Paisley and her mom, Amanda last week. Together, they started by sorting various pom poms by color. Then, Paisley was able to graph each color by size, going from biggest to smallest. After the graph was made, Paisley counted how many there were of each color. This simple activity provided parent-child interaction, while promoting the early math skills of color identification, graphing, counting, and categorizing. Mrs. Campbell's students at MMS learned about Greek City-states, Sparta and Athens. Sparta was a warlike city-state that prized courage and obedience above all else. Athens prized the mind and education.
Then they chose which one they wanted to "live in." For the next two weeks, they engaged in feats of knowledge and strength to earn points for their city-state. They did a strength challenge between the Spartans and Athenians. They showed their skills doing push-ups, sit-ups, and arm wrestling.
Spartans earned the most points and won our Peloponnesian War! Oddly enough, the Spartans won the ACTUAL Peloponnesian War too.
